Here are today’s top stories in no particular order:

  • President Barack Obama’s economic recovery stimulus plan has passed in the Senate. The plan is believed to seek close to $1 trillion in relief.
  • General Motors Corp announced 10,000 new job cuts expected for this year, while most of the additional employees will see their pay cut.
  • Athletes in the dog house: New York Yankee Alex Rodriquez’s admission to steroid use may result in loss of sponsorship money. The people at Nike and Guitar Hero are considering severing their ties with the star. Ironically, Michael Phelps and A-Rod appeared together in the Guitar Hero ad.
  • Jewcy featured artist/T-shirt designer Christopher Sauvereceived a cease-and desist-notice from celeb-stylist Rachel Zoe’s lawyers. They claimed that the skeletal stylist has the terms "I die" and "Bananas" trademarked and he must stop selling his t-shirts immediately.  
  • Singers and couple Chris Brown and Rhianna were noticeably absent from Sunday’s Grammy Awards as details emerge that the night before Chris Brown assaulted Rhianna and is currently facing charges.
